#bf993c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#bf993c is composed of 74.9% red, 60%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.9% magenta, 68.6%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 42.6 degrees, a saturation of 52.2% and a lightness of 49.2%. #bf993c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ff78 with #7f3300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

● #bf993c color description : Moderate orange.
The hexadecimal color #bf993c has RGB values of R:191, G:153,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.69,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12556604.
